Output 351bb6a37d789ffa8e2ea2d9de341b8ace68ac674a6d785277797806cae56879:0

value
124736836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ab7af7775405e5b0bf17aab2f1c59023b7322a9 OP_EQUAL
address
3CstQdhX1gDyWEre1Gybx7Ew5hjsTvfv1X
transaction
351bb6a37d789ffa8e2ea2d9de341b8ace68ac674a6d785277797806cae56879
confirmations
315269
spent
true